This Thai beef stir fry is a delightful combination of tender beef and vibrant vegetables, all coated in a savory sauce. It's a quick and easy dish that brings the bold flavors of Thai cuisine to your dinner table. Perfect for a weeknight meal, this stir fry is sure to become a family favorite.
Some ingredients in this recipe might not be staples in your pantry. Oyster sauce and fish sauce are essential for authentic Thai flavor but may require a trip to the international aisle of your supermarket. Additionally, snow peas and julienned carrots might not be common in every household, so be sure to pick them up fresh from the produce section.

Ingredients For Thai Beef Stir Fry Recipe
Beef: Thinly sliced for quick cooking and tenderness.
Soy sauce: Adds a salty, umami flavor to the dish.
Oyster sauce: Provides a rich, savory depth to the stir fry.
Fish sauce: Adds a distinct, salty, and slightly fishy flavor essential in Thai cuisine.
Brown sugar: Balances the savory and salty flavors with a touch of sweetness.
Garlic: Minced to infuse the oil with its aromatic flavor.
Vegetable oil: Used for stir-frying the ingredients.
Bell pepper: Sliced for a sweet and crunchy texture.
Onion: Sliced to add a mild, sweet flavor.
Broccoli florets: Adds a nutritious, crunchy element to the dish.
Carrot: Julienne cut for a slightly sweet and crisp texture.
Snow peas: Adds a fresh, crisp bite to the stir fry.
Cornstarch: Mixed with water to thicken the sauce.
Technique Tip for This Recipe
When stir-frying, make sure to slice the beef thinly and against the grain. This ensures that the meat remains tender and cooks quickly. Additionally, keep the wok or pan very hot to achieve a good sear on the vegetables and beef, which helps to lock in the flavors.
Suggested Side Dishes
Alternative Ingredients
beef - Substitute with chicken: Chicken is a leaner protein and can absorb the flavors of the sauces well.
soy sauce - Substitute with tamari: Tamari is a gluten-free alternative that provides a similar umami flavor.
oyster sauce - Substitute with hoisin sauce: Hoisin sauce offers a sweet and savory flavor profile similar to oyster sauce.
fish sauce - Substitute with soy sauce: Soy sauce can provide a similar salty and umami flavor, though it lacks the fishy undertone.
brown sugar - Substitute with honey: Honey adds sweetness and a slight floral note, which can complement the dish.
garlic - Substitute with garlic powder: Garlic powder can provide a similar flavor, though it is less pungent than fresh garlic.
vegetable oil - Substitute with canola oil: Canola oil has a neutral flavor and a high smoke point, making it suitable for stir-frying.
bell pepper - Substitute with zucchini: Zucchini has a similar texture and can absorb the flavors of the stir fry well.
onion - Substitute with shallots: Shallots offer a milder and slightly sweeter flavor compared to onions.
broccoli florets - Substitute with cauliflower florets: Cauliflower has a similar texture and can be used in the same way as broccoli.
carrot - Substitute with parsnip: Parsnip has a similar texture and sweetness, making it a good alternative to carrots.
snow peas - Substitute with sugar snap peas: Sugar snap peas have a similar crunch and sweetness, making them a suitable substitute.
cornstarch - Substitute with arrowroot powder: Arrowroot powder can thicken sauces in a similar way to cornstarch.
Alternative Recipes Similar to This Dish
How to Store or Freeze This Dish
Allow the Thai Beef Stir Fry to cool to room temperature before storing. This helps to prevent condensation, which can make the dish soggy.
Transfer the stir fry into an airtight container. If you have multiple portions, consider using separate containers to make reheating easier.
Label the containers with the date of preparation. This helps you keep track of how long the stir fry has been stored.
Store the containers in the refrigerator if you plan to consume the stir fry within 3-4 days. This ensures the beef and vegetables remain fresh.
For longer storage, place the containers in the freezer. The Thai Beef Stir Fry can be frozen for up to 2-3 months without significant loss of flavor or texture.
When ready to eat, thaw the frozen stir fry in the refrigerator overnight. This gradual thawing helps maintain the quality of the beef and vegetables.
Reheat the stir fry in a wok or skillet over medium heat. Add a splash of water or broth to help revive the sauce and prevent the dish from drying out.
Alternatively, you can reheat in the microwave. Place the stir fry in a microwave-safe dish, cover loosely, and heat on high for 2-3 minutes, stirring halfway through to ensure even heating.
Always check the temperature of the stir fry before serving. It should be steaming hot throughout to ensure it is safe to eat.
Enjoy your Thai Beef Stir Fry with freshly steamed rice or noodles for a quick and delicious meal.
How to Reheat Leftovers
Stovetop Method:
- Heat a non-stick skillet over medium heat.
- Add a splash of vegetable oil to the pan.
- Once the oil is hot, add the leftover Thai beef stir fry.
- Stir occasionally to ensure even heating, cooking for about 5-7 minutes or until the beef and vegetables are heated through.
- If the stir fry seems dry, add a tablespoon of water or broth to help rehydrate the dish.
Microwave Method:
- Place the leftover stir fry in a microwave-safe dish.
- Cover the dish with a microwave-safe lid or plastic wrap with a few holes poked in it to allow steam to escape.
- Microwave on medium power for 2-3 minutes.
- Stir the stir fry halfway through to ensure even heating.
- Continue microwaving in 1-minute intervals until the dish is heated through.
Oven Method:
- Preheat your oven to 350°F (175°C).
- Place the leftover stir fry in an oven-safe dish.
- Cover the dish with aluminum foil to prevent it from drying out.
- Bake for about 15-20 minutes or until the beef and vegetables are heated through.
- Stir halfway through the reheating process to ensure even heating.
Steam Method:
- Set up a steamer basket over a pot of simmering water.
- Place the leftover stir fry in the steamer basket.
- Cover and steam for about 5-7 minutes or until the beef and vegetables are heated through.
- This method helps retain moisture and keeps the stir fry from drying out.
Best Tools for This Recipe
Wok: A versatile and deep pan ideal for stir-frying, allowing for even cooking and quick heat distribution.
Mixing bowl: Used to combine the soy sauce, oyster sauce, fish sauce, and brown sugar into a uniform mixture.
Knife: Essential for thinly slicing the beef and preparing the vegetables like bell pepper, onion, broccoli, carrot, and snow peas.
Cutting board: Provides a stable surface for safely chopping and slicing all the ingredients.
Measuring spoons: Ensures accurate measurement of the soy sauce, oyster sauce, fish sauce, brown sugar, and cornstarch.
Garlic press: Convenient tool for mincing garlic quickly and efficiently.
Spatula: Used for stirring and tossing the ingredients in the wok to ensure even cooking.
Small bowl: Useful for mixing the cornstarch with water to create the slurry.
Serving dish: For presenting the finished Thai beef stir fry attractively.
Rice cooker: Ideal for preparing the steamed rice to serve alongside the stir fry.
How to Save Time on This Recipe
Prep ingredients in advance: Slice the beef and chop the vegetables ahead of time to streamline the cooking process.
Use pre-cut veggies: Purchase pre-cut bell pepper, onion, broccoli florets, carrot, and snow peas to save chopping time.
Marinate the beef: Mix the soy sauce, oyster sauce, fish sauce, and brown sugar with the beef and let it marinate while you prep other ingredients.
Cook in batches: Stir-fry the beef and vegetables separately to ensure even cooking and avoid overcrowding the wok.
Use a hot wok: Ensure the wok is hot before adding ingredients to speed up the cooking process and achieve a good sear.

Thai Beef Stir Fry
Ingredients
Main Ingredients
- 1 lb Beef, thinly sliced
- 2 tablespoon Soy sauce
- 1 tablespoon Oyster sauce
- 1 tablespoon Fish sauce
- 1 tablespoon Brown sugar
- 2 cloves Garlic, minced
- 1 tablespoon Vegetable oil
- 1 cup Bell pepper, sliced
- 1 cup Onion, sliced
- 1 cup Broccoli florets
- 1 cup Carrot, julienned
- 1 cup Snow peas
- 1 tablespoon Cornstarch mixed with 2 tablespoon water
Instructions
- 1. In a bowl, mix soy sauce, oyster sauce, fish sauce, and brown sugar. Set aside.
- 2. Heat oil in a wok over medium-high heat. Add garlic and stir-fry until fragrant.
- 3. Add beef and stir-fry until browned. Remove beef and set aside.
- 4. In the same wok, add bell pepper, onion, broccoli, carrot, and snow peas. Stir-fry for 3-4 minutes.
- 5. Return beef to the wok. Add the sauce mixture and cornstarch slurry. Stir well until the sauce thickens.
- 6. Serve hot with steamed rice.
Nutritional Value
Keywords
Suggested Appetizers and Desserts
More Amazing Recipes to Try 🙂
- Thai Crispy Duck Recipe1 Hours 20 Minutes
- Thai Meat Dishes Recipe50 Minutes
- Thai Sesame Salmon Recipe35 Minutes
- Thai Coconut Rice In Rice Cooker Recipe30 Minutes
- Thai Tofu Curry With Coconut Milk Recipe35 Minutes
- Thai Ginger Beef Recipe35 Minutes
- Thai Basmati Rice Recipe30 Minutes
- Thai Tea Protein Powder Recipe5 Minutes
Leave a Reply